Jiangsu Expressway Company Limited - Business Model: Key Partnerships
Jiangsu Expressway Company Limited, a leading operator of expressways in China, heavily relies on a network of key partnerships to maintain its operational efficiency and achieve its strategic goals. Below are the main categories of partnerships that play a crucial role in the company's business model.
Government Agencies
Partnerships with government agencies are vital for Jiangsu Expressway. The company collaborates with various local and national governmental bodies to ensure compliance with regulations and to secure project approvals. In 2022, Jiangsu Expressway reported a government subsidy income of approximately ¥500 million ($76 million), highlighting the significance of these partnerships in supporting infrastructure projects.
Construction Companies
Jiangsu Expressway partners with multiple construction firms for the development and expansion of its road networks. In 2022, the company awarded contracts worth about ¥1.2 billion ($182 million) to construction companies for new projects, which includes maintenance and upgrade of existing roads. Key construction partners include China Communications Construction Company and China Railway Group, both recognized for their large-scale infrastructure capabilities.
Maintenance Service Providers
To ensure the safety and durability of its expressways, Jiangsu Expressway collaborates with specialized maintenance service providers. In 2022, these partnerships led to an expenditure of around ¥300 million ($45 million) for routine and emergency maintenance services. This collaboration is crucial for maintaining operational efficiency and reducing potential liabilities associated with roadway safety.
Financial Institutions
Financial partnerships are essential for funding Jiangsu Expressway's extensive projects. The company has established relationships with various banks and financial institutions for loans and investment. As of 2022, the total outstanding debt was approximately ¥12 billion ($1.83 billion), providing a solid base for financing future infrastructure projects. Jiangsu Expressway has received financing from leading banks like Bank of China and Industrial and Commercial Bank of China.

Jiangsu Expressway Company Limited - Business Model: Key Activities
The key activities of Jiangsu Expressway Company Limited (Jiangsu Expressway) play an essential role in executing its value proposition, focusing on the construction, management, and maintenance of expressways in Jiangsu Province, China.
Road Construction and Maintenance
Jiangsu Expressway is deeply involved in the development and upkeep of expressways. In 2022, the company recorded an investment of approximately RMB 4.5 billion in road construction projects. The company maintains over 1,200 kilometers of expressway network, which contributes significantly to regional connectivity and economic growth. The average daily traffic volume on these roads exceeds 1.8 million vehicles, which necessitates ongoing maintenance and upgrades.
Toll Management
The toll collection process is vital for Jiangsu Expressway's revenue generation. In 2022, the company collected approximately RMB 9.3 billion in toll revenue. The average toll fee per vehicle fluctuates between RMB 30 to RMB 120, based on vehicle type and road segment. The toll management system employs advanced technologies including Electronic Toll Collection (ETC), which saw a 10% year-over-year increase in usage, streamlining the payment process for customers.
Traffic Monitoring
Effective traffic monitoring is crucial for optimizing road usage and ensuring safety. Jiangsu Expressway utilizes a network of over 1,500 surveillance cameras across its expressway system to monitor traffic flow and incidents. In 2022, the company reported a 25% reduction in traffic accidents due to improved monitoring and quick response protocols. Moreover, the implementation of smart traffic management systems enhanced real-time data collection by 15%.
Customer Service
Customer service is an integral activity enabling Jiangsu Expressway to enhance user satisfaction. The company operates a 24/7 customer service hotline, managing more than 1 million customer inquiries annually. It also launched a mobile app that facilitates information access, complaints, and feedback, which saw an increase in user engagement by 20% in the last year.

Jiangsu Expressway Company Limited - Business Model: Key Resources
Skilled workforce is fundamental to the operations of Jiangsu Expressway Company Limited, which employs over 12,000 staff members. The company invests significantly in training and development programs, committing approximately RMB 50 million annually to enhance employee skills and operational efficiency. The workforce includes engineers, traffic management professionals, and customer service representatives, all essential for maintaining high service standards and operational excellence.
Advanced toll technology is another key resource. Jiangsu Expressway utilizes electronic toll collection systems (ETC) to streamline the tolling process, significantly reducing wait times for vehicles. In 2022, the company reported that ETC accounted for approximately 80% of total toll collections, reflecting a 15% increase from the previous year. The investment in upgrading toll equipment reached around RMB 100 million during this period, ensuring efficiency and enhanced user experience.
The company’s road infrastructure is vital for its operations, encompassing over 1,300 kilometers of managed expressways as of the end of 2022. The total value of its road assets is estimated at over RMB 150 billion. Maintaining this extensive infrastructure requires substantial capital expenditure; in 2022, Jiangsu Expressway allocated RMB 1.2 billion for routine maintenance and upgrades to ensure safety and reliability.

Regulatory permits are also crucial. The company operates under several regulatory frameworks, holding over 150 operational licenses across various jurisdictions. These permits are essential for toll operations and infrastructure development. Jiangsu Expressway has successfully renewed its licenses, ensuring compliance with local regulations, which is a significant barrier to entry for new competitors. In 2023, the company reported zero regulatory violations, showcasing its commitment to adherence to legal standards.

Jiangsu Expressway Company Limited - Business Model: Customer Segments
The customer segments of Jiangsu Expressway Company Limited (JEC) are diverse, catering to various groups that utilize its extensive expressway network. Each segment has distinct characteristics and needs, contributing significantly to the company's revenue through toll collections and associated services.
Daily commuters
Daily commuters represent a substantial portion of JEC's customer base. In 2022, approximately 60% of the daily traffic on Jiangsu's expressways consisted of personal vehicles used for commuting. The average toll rate for these vehicles typically ranges from ¥0.3 to ¥0.8 per kilometer. With over 200,000 daily trips recorded, this segment generates considerable revenue through toll fees.
Logistics companies
Logistics companies are vital customers, as they require efficient transportation routes for goods distribution. In 2023, JEC reported that logistics traffic accounted for about 25% of total expressway traffic. The average fee for heavy freight vehicles is approximately ¥1.2 per kilometer. Given that logistics companies utilize the expressways extensively, they contribute significantly to JEC's annual revenues, which reached approximately ¥3.5 billion in 2022.
Tourists and travelers
Tourists and travelers represent an essential segment, particularly during peak travel seasons. In 2022, it was estimated that around 15% of expressway users were tourists. The peak travel periods include national holidays, with traffic increasing by more than 30% during these times. The average toll for passenger vehicles is similar to that of daily commuters, but tourists may also contribute to revenue through services such as rest areas and gas stations located along the expressway network.
Local businesses
Local businesses near expressway exits also benefit from JEC's infrastructure. These include service stations, restaurants, and retail outlets that see increased customer footfall due to expressway accessibility. In recent years, JEC has partnered with over 300 local businesses, driving not only their growth but also enhancing JEC's value proposition of offering convenient services. Local businesses have reported a 20% increase in sales attributed to expressway traffic, illustrating the symbiotic relationship between JEC and its surrounding community.

Jiangsu Expressway Company Limited - Business Model: Cost Structure
The cost structure of Jiangsu Expressway Company Limited (JEC), a key player in the transportation infrastructure sector in China, comprises various expenses essential for the maintenance and operation of its expressway networks. This structure mainly consists of infrastructure maintenance, labor expenses, technology investments, and administrative costs.
Infrastructure Maintenance
Maintaining the extensive network of expressways is a significant commitment for Jiangsu Expressway. In 2022, the company reported a maintenance expense of approximately RMB 1.3 billion, which accounted for around 15% of total operational costs. This expenditure includes routine inspections, repairs, and upgrades to ensure the safety and efficiency of the roadways.
Labor Expenses
Labor costs represent a crucial element of JEC's cost structure. As of the latest financial report, the company employed about 3,500 staff members, resulting in a total labor expense of around RMB 600 million annually. This figure includes salaries, benefits, and training costs, reflecting the company's commitment to maintaining a skilled workforce.
Technology Investments
Investments in technology are vital for improving operational efficiency. Jiangsu Expressway allocated approximately RMB 500 million in 2022 towards technology upgrades, including toll collection systems and traffic management systems. This investment is part of a broader strategy to enhance customer experience and streamline operations.
Administrative Costs
Administrative expenses encompass costs related to management, office operations, and regulatory compliance. In the most recent fiscal year, JEC reported administrative costs of about RMB 400 million, representing about 5% of the total cost structure. This includes expenses for office supplies, utilities, and other essential overheads.

Jiangsu Expressway Company Limited - Business Model: Revenue Streams
The primary revenue stream for Jiangsu Expressway Company Limited comes from toll fees. The company manages a network of expressways, charging vehicles for access. In 2022, the total toll revenue reached approximately RMB 9.5 billion, reflecting a growth of approximately 3% compared to the previous year. The overall traffic volume increased, contributing to this rise. The average toll fee varied depending on the vehicle type, with passenger cars generally paying around RMB 0.3 per kilometer.
Another significant revenue source is from advertising spaces. Jiangsu Expressway has established partnerships with various companies to utilize advertising along its expressways. In 2022, revenue generated from advertising was around RMB 200 million, showcasing a steady demand for this service as companies seek to reach a broad audience of travelers. The advertising strategy includes billboards and electronic displays strategically placed on key routes.
Service concessions also play a vital role in the company's revenue model. Jiangsu Expressway offers services such as fuel stations and rest areas on its expressways. Revenue from these concessions in 2022 was approximately RMB 350 million. The growing demand for convenient services on travel routes has bolstered this revenue segment, highlighting the potential for expansion in service offerings to travelers.
Finally, government funding provides financial support, especially for infrastructure maintenance and expansion projects. In 2022, Jiangsu Expressway received approximately RMB 1.2 billion in government subsidies, aiding in the financing of toll road upgrades and improvements. This funding reflects the government’s commitment to maintaining transportation infrastructure as part of broader economic development strategies.
